Household hazardous waste

Drop off your household hazardous waste for safe disposal or reuse. Throwing household hazardous waste in the trash or pouring it down the drain is dangerous and harmful to the environment.

Eligibility and cost

  • Free for Austin and Travis County residents.
  • Fees apply if you do not live in Austin or Travis County.
  • Businesses are not eligible to drop off hazardous waste. For information about how businesses can dispose of hazardous waste, call 512-974-4335.

Accepted items

We accept most household chemicals and many other items that contain hazardous materials. To see whether we accept an item, use the What Do I Do With? tool or see the list of accepted and not accepted items.

Safety guidelines

  • Bring products in original containers; do not mix.
  • Bring items in 5-gallon (or smaller) containers.
  • Put small containers upright in sturdy boxes.
  • If something is leaking, put it in a container and absorb the spill with cat litter.

Tires

There is a fee to drop off tires. The fee depends on the size of the tire:

  • 19 in. or smaller – $6 each
  • 20 in. or larger – $7 each

Brush and yard trimmings

Brush drop off has movedto the Hornsby Bend Biosolids Management Plant.Effective September 1, 2021, the Recycle & Reuse Drop-off Center will no longer accept brush drop off but will divert their customers to the Hornsby location at 2210 FM 973. The new location has a much larger capacity for brush drop off and will prevent some of the traffic jams and safety hazards previously experienced at the multi-purpose Recycle & Reuse Drop-off Center. No appointment is necessary at Hornsby.

ReUse Store

Many materials that are dropped off at the center are in usable condition. These items go to the ReUse Store, where other people can pick them up.

The ReUse Store is free for everyone.

Availability varies, but items include:

  • Art supplies
  • Cleaning products
  • Household chemicals
  • Automotive fluids

Austin ReBlend Paint

Austin ReBlend paint is recycled from paint dropped off at the center. Austin ReBlend paint is free for individuals, nonprofits and businesses.

Mulch

Mulch is available for pickup. You must load the mulch yourself. Mulch is free for everyone.

What to bring

  • Pitchfork or shovel
  • Work gloves
  • Containers for mulch
